Description du produit

Messier’s catalog of 110 star clusters, nebulae, and galaxies is the most popular list of deep sky gems. The first edition of this stunning reference atlas was hailed as the most comprehensive, detailed, and beautiful account of the Messier objects then available and the second edition continues this trend.

Each object is presented with:

  • Updated historical information, including from new sources, such as William Herschel, featuring accounts and anecdotes from Messier and other prominent visual observers who followed him
  • Thoroughly researched astrophysical information, the results of an investigation of more than 500 recent scientific papers including, for the first time, fully consistent distance data from the Gaia space observatory
  • Extensive information on visual observing using the naked eye, binoculars, and amateur telescopes from modest sizes up to 20 inches aperture.
  • New large-scale color photos from some of the world’s best amateurs displaying the objects’ splendor, as well as close-up images from the Hubble Space Telescope, for some objects, showing the fine details.

The introductory section includes an extensive biographical portrait of the life of Charles Messier, his observations and his telescopes, and his contemporaries, and a complete translation of Messier’s original catalog. There is also detailed information on how to observe the Messier objects and advice on how to conduct a Messier Marathon.

For those seeking even more, the author provides the Herschel 100 list.

In addition, many objects feature historical sketches from classical observers from the nineteenth century alongside the author’s modern deep-sky drawings.

The author Ronald Stoyan is the proprietor of the independent German publisher Oculum-Verlag, which specializes in amateur astronomy books. He has authored or co-authored twelve books on practical astronomy, including Atlas of the Messier Objects, The Cambridge Photographic Star Atlas, The Atlas of Great Comets and interstellarum Deep Sky Atlas.
